Daffodil details
Registered? |
Yes |
Division |
2 |
Perianth colour(s) |
W |
Corona colour(s) |
W |
Originator name |
MalcolmWheeler |
Date of first flowering |
2011 |
Registrant name |
MalcolmWheeler |
Year of registration |
2022 |
Seed parent |
{N. atlanticus} |
Pollen parent |
{N. watieri} hybrid |
Seedling number |
M126 |
Description |
Fl. forming a double triangle, 30mm wide; perianth segments 13mm long, roundish, blunt, prominently mucronate, spreading, plane, smooth and of heavy substance, overlapping half; the inner segments narrower, ovate, scarcely mucronate; corona 6mm long, cup-shaped, ribbed, mouth even and a little flared, with rim entire. Dwarf. Early. Sweetly scented |
